Lumbini, Nepal, is renowned as the birthplace of Siddhartha Gautama, who became the Buddha, making it a significant pilgrimage site for Buddhists globally. The culture of Lumbini is deeply intertwined with Buddhist traditions, featuring numerous monasteries, stupas, and sacred gardens that reflect a blend of religious devotion and historical significance. The area hosts various festivals and rituals, attracting visitors and devotees who engage in meditation and spiritual practices. Additionally, the local community exhibits a rich tapestry of Nepali customs, traditions, and hospitality, enhancing its cultural vibrancy.
